Understanding BscScan: The Gateway to BNB Smart Chain Exploration


BscScan is essentially a blockchain explorer that serves as a comprehensive tool for users looking to monitor activities on the BNB Smart Chain (BSC), often referred to simply as "Binance Smart Chain" in recent discussions. This platform allows users to track transactions, addresses, tokens, and prices related to their holdings within the ecosystem facilitated by BSC. The use of BscScan is crucial for both traders and developers alike, offering a wealth of information necessary for decision-making, risk assessment, and innovation on this burgeoning blockchain network.


Navigating the Binance Smart Chain: The Role of MetaMask


MetaMask, an Ethereum-based cryptocurrency wallet that also supports various other smart chains like BSC, plays a pivotal role in connecting users directly to the blockchain. It serves as a gateway to dApps and tokens on the selected network, enabling seamless interactions without needing to leave the MetaMask interface. For those interested in exploring the BSC ecosystem, adding it to their MetaMask wallet is essential for accessing its full potential.
